She has her critics, but even the most ardent of them would have to admit that Nia Jax enjoyed a pretty impressive 2017. She did pretty much everything, in fact, apart from win title gold - including an appearance in WrestleMania's primary women's match.

The predicament she now finds herself in, however, is and has been pretty clear to see since the inter-brand elimination match a couple of weeks back at Survivor Series. She's supposed to be the female division's version of Braun Strowman, and yet Asuka looks far more imposing in the ring.

Worse, few are getting excited about the possibility of seeing the Empress of Tomorrow lock horns with Nia. That combination is probably a distant sixth or seventh in the list of potential match-ups, some way behind the prospect of Asuka going one-on-one with Charlotte.

If she carries on improving at the current rate, there's no reason to believe she'll be surplus to requirements (especially now that the women's division appears to be expanding further) but as a title-chasing star?

We're not convinced.
